This will be my 3rd all grain batch. I am brewing a Belgian Blonde Ale. I will show the recipe at the bottom. Just want to get this question out of the way.
This recipe calls for a 60min Saach' Rest @ 150F. It doesn't indicate a mash out or fly sparge/batch sparge, or give any other instructions on the mash.
Question is, do I just put all my water in the MLT at one shot? And just have it sit for 60 mins at 150F and than drain it all into my kettle (ofcourse voorlof as well)? I am just a little confused and some advice would be greatly appreciated.
Recipe
--------
White Labs Abby Ale Yeast
11 Lbs Pilsner
1 Lbs CaraFoam
1oz Hallerttau @ 60 min
1oz Fuggle @ 5
Saach Rest for 60 min @ 150F
Ferment for 21 days in primary
